Wenbanyama will be exempt from suspension and will play in Game 5 of the series as scheduled.

May 12 - According to the Associated Press, a source familiar with the matter revealed that Victor Wimbledonyama will not face further NBA punishment for elbowing Naz Reed in Game 4 of the Western Conference Semifinals. He will be able to play in Game 5 of the series.

Early in the second quarter of Game 4 , Wimbledon got into a physical altercation with Reed and Jaden McDaniels while battling for a rebound , and subsequently elbowed Reed. After reviewing the video, the referees upgraded the initial call to a Flagrant Foul 2, ejecting Wimbledon from the game. This was the first ejection of Wimbledon's career.

 

According to statistics, this is the third time this season that Wajnaya has been called for a flagrant foul. The French center was unanimously named Defensive Player of the Year and is also a finalist for MVP . The Spurs and Timberwolves series is currently tied 2-2 .
